As businesses continue the trend toward globalization, the demand for teachers of ESL continues. APSU’s Graduate Certificate in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ages develops educators to instruct non-English speakers in settings from private schools to online and abroad.

This online ESL graduate certificate can be earned in a matter of months. Graduates receive a TESOL certificate. All credit hours can be transferred to the Master of Arts in TESOL, if you choose to continue your education.

Students delve into research around literacy, linguistics, and assessments. Some topics covered in the online coursework include the following:

  • Contemporary theories
  • Pedagogies
  • Research in TESOL curriculum and instruction

Experienced faculty prepare students for successful classroom instruction in ESL. Their years of practical experience in this field impart the finer points of this culturally-sensitive field.
